There are 321,000 people living in the Dudley region. The majority of the population falls within the 40-59 age group. The area has an economically active population of 145,500 people, or 76.2% of the total population. The unemployment rate (4.7%) is high compared to the rest of the UK. Across the United Kingdom, the annual gross salary is just over £30,500 on average. In the region of Dudley, it averages £28,043.
